import path = require('path');
import tl = require('azure-pipelines-task-lib/task');
import apim = require('azure-devops-node-api');
import * as lim from 'azure-devops-node-api/interfaces/LocationsInterfaces';
import os = require('os');
import { ToolRunner } from 'azure-pipelines-task-lib/toolrunner';
var utils = require('./utils.js');
const testRunIdLineRegexp = /Test run id: "([^"]+)"/;
function getEndpointAPIToken(endpointInputFieldName) {
var errorMessage = tl.loc("CannotDecodeEndpoint");
var endpoint = tl.getInput(endpointInputFieldName, true);
if (!endpoint) {
throw new Error(errorMessage);
}
let authToken = tl.getEndpointAuthorizationParameter(endpoint, 'apitoken', false);
return authToken;
}
function resolveInputPatternToOneFile(inputName: string, required: boolean, name: string): string {
let pattern = tl.getInput(inputName, required);
if (!pattern) {
return null;
}
let resolved = utils.resolveSinglePath(pattern);
tl.checkPath(resolved, name);
return resolved;
}
function addArg(argName: string, getInput: () => string, tr: ToolRunner) {
let arg = getInput();
if (arg) {
tr.arg([argName, arg]);
}
}
function addStringArg(argName: string, inputName: string, required: boolean, tr: ToolRunner) {
addArg(argName, () => { return tl.getInput(inputName, required) }, tr);
}
function addBooleanArg(argName: string, inputName: string, tr: ToolRunner) {
let booleanArg = tl.getBoolInput(inputName, false);
if (booleanArg) {
tr.arg(argName);
}
}
function addOptionalWildcardArg(argName: string, inputName: string, tr: ToolRunner) {
addArg(argName, () => { return resolveInputPatternToOneFile(inputName, false, inputName) }, tr);
}
function getCliPath(): string {
let userDefinedPath = tl.getInput("cliLocationOverride", false);
if (utils.checkAndFixFilePath(userDefinedPath, "cli path")) {
return userDefinedPath;
}
let systemPath = tl.which('appcenter', false);
if (systemPath) {
return systemPath;
}
// On Windows (Hosted Agent) we attempt to use the bundled appcenter cli as user doesn't have any
// chance to install the CLI themselves. On Mac the bundled appcenter does not work due to some
// path issues.
let isWindows = os.type().match(/^Win/);
if (isWindows) {
let cliPath = path.join(__dirname, "node_modules", ".bin", "appcenter.cmd");
return cliPath;
}
// Failed to locate CLI
throw new Error(tl.loc('CannotLocateAppCenterCLI'));;
}
function getPrepareRunner(cliPath: string, debug: boolean, app: string, artifactsDir: string): ToolRunner {
// Get Test Prepare inputs
let prepareRunner = tl.tool(cliPath);
let framework: string = tl.getInput('framework', true);
// framework agnositic options
prepareRunner.arg(['test', 'prepare', framework]);
prepareRunner.arg(['--artifacts-dir', artifactsDir]);
// framework specific options -- appium
if (framework === 'appium') {
addStringArg('--build-dir', 'appiumBuildDir', true, prepareRunner);
} else if (framework === 'espresso') {
addStringArg('--build-dir', 'espressoBuildDir', false, prepareRunner);
addOptionalWildcardArg('--test-apk-path', 'espressoTestApkPath', prepareRunner);
} else if (framework === 'calabash') {
prepareRunner.arg(['--app-path', app]);
addStringArg('--project-dir', 'calabashProjectDir', true, prepareRunner);
addStringArg('--sign-info', 'signInfo', false, prepareRunner);
if (tl.filePathSupplied('calabashConfigFile')) {
addStringArg('--config-path', 'calabashConfigFile', false, prepareRunner);
}
addStringArg('--profile', 'calabashProfile', false, prepareRunner);
addBooleanArg('--skip-config-check', 'calabashSkipConfigCheck', prepareRunner);
} else if (framework === 'uitest') {
prepareRunner.arg(['--app-path', app]);
addStringArg('--build-dir', 'uitestBuildDir', true, prepareRunner);
addStringArg('--store-path', 'uitestStorePath', false, prepareRunner);
addStringArg('--store-password', 'uitestStorePass', false, prepareRunner);
addStringArg('--key-alias', 'uitestKeyAlias', false, prepareRunner);
addStringArg('--key-password', 'uitestKeyPass', false, prepareRunner);
addStringArg('--uitest-tools-dir', 'uitestToolsDir', false, prepareRunner);
addStringArg('--sign-info', 'signInfo', false, prepareRunner);
} else if (framework === 'xcuitest') {
addStringArg('--build-dir', 'xcuitestBuildDir', false, prepareRunner);
addStringArg('--test-ipa-path', 'xcuitestTestIpaPath', false, prepareRunner);
}
// append user defined inputs
let prepareOpts = tl.getInput('prepareOpts', false);
if (prepareOpts) {
prepareRunner.line(prepareOpts);
}
if (debug) {
prepareRunner.arg('--debug');
}
prepareRunner.arg('--quiet');
return prepareRunner;
}
function getLoginRunner(cliPath: string, debug: boolean, credsType: string): ToolRunner {
let loginRunner = tl.tool(cliPath);
if (credsType === 'inputs') {
let username: string = tl.getInput('username', true);
let password: string = tl.getInput('password', true);
loginRunner.arg(['login', '-u', username, '-p', password]);
if (debug) {
loginRunner.arg('--debug');
}
let loginOpts = tl.getInput('loginOpts', false);
if (loginOpts) {
loginRunner.line(loginOpts);
}
loginRunner.arg('--quiet');
}
return loginRunner;
}
function getTestRunner(cliPath: string, debug: boolean, app: string, artifactsDir: string, credsType: string): ToolRunner {
let testRunner = tl.tool(cliPath);
let appSlug: string = tl.getInput('appSlug', true);
testRunner.arg(['test', 'run', 'manifest']);
testRunner.arg(['--manifest-path', `${path.join(artifactsDir, 'manifest.json')}`]);
testRunner.arg(['--app-path', app, '--app', appSlug]);
addStringArg('--devices', 'devices', true, testRunner);
addStringArg('--test-series', 'series', false, testRunner);
addStringArg('--dsym-dir', 'dsymDir', false, testRunner);
addBooleanArg('--async', 'async', testRunner);
let locale: string = tl.getInput('locale', true);
if (locale === 'user') {
tl.debug('Use user defined locale.');
locale = tl.getInput('userDefinedLocale', true);
}
testRunner.arg(['--locale', locale]);
let runOptions: string = tl.getInput('runOpts', false);
if (runOptions) {
testRunner.line(runOptions);
}
if (debug) {
testRunner.arg('--debug');
}
testRunner.arg('--quiet');
if (credsType === 'serviceEndpoint') {
// add api key
let apiToken = getEndpointAPIToken('serverEndpoint');
testRunner.arg(['--token', apiToken]);
}
testRunner.on('stdline', line => {
let match = testRunIdLineRegexp.exec(line);
if (match) {
setTestRunIdBuildPropertyAsync(match[1]);
}
});
return testRunner;
}
async function setTestRunIdBuildPropertyAsync(testRunId: string) {
try {
let url = tl.getEndpointUrl('SYSTEMVSSCONNECTION', false);
let token = tl.getEndpointAuthorizationParameter('SYSTEMVSSCONNECTION', 'ACCESSTOKEN', false);
let projectId = tl.getVariable('System.TeamProjectId');
let buildId = tl.getVariable('Build.BuildId');
let auth = token.length == 52 ? apim.getPersonalAccessTokenHandler(token) : apim.getBearerHandler(token);
let vsts: apim.WebApi = new apim.WebApi(url, auth);
let conn: lim.ConnectionData = await vsts.connect();
let buildApi = await vsts.getBuildApi();
let patch = [
{
op: "replace",
path: "/mobile-center-test-run-id",
value: testRunId
}
];
await buildApi.updateBuildProperties(null, patch, projectId, parseInt(buildId));
}
catch (err) {
tl.warning(`Cannot set build property /mobile-center/test-run-id: ${err}`);
}
}
async function run() {
tl.setResourcePath(path.join(__dirname, 'task.json'));
let cliPath = getCliPath();
let loggedIn = false;
let testRunId: string = null;
try {
tl.checkPath(cliPath, "CLI for Visual Studio App Center");
let debug: boolean = tl.getBoolInput('debug', false);
let prepareTests: boolean = tl.getBoolInput('enablePrepare', false);
let runTests: boolean = tl.getBoolInput('enableRun', false);
let artifactsDir = tl.getInput('artifactsDir', true);
let credsType = tl.getInput('credsType', true);
// Get app info
let app = resolveInputPatternToOneFile('app', true, "Binary File");
// Test prepare
if (prepareTests) {
let prepareRunner = getPrepareRunner(cliPath, debug, app, artifactsDir);
await prepareRunner.exec();
}
// Test run
if (runTests) {
// login if necessary
if (credsType === 'inputs') {
let loginRunner = getLoginRunner(cliPath, debug, credsType);
await loginRunner.exec();
loggedIn = true;
}
let testRunner = getTestRunner(cliPath, debug, app, artifactsDir, credsType);
await testRunner.exec();
}
tl.setResult(tl.TaskResult.Succeeded, tl.loc("Succeeded"));
} catch (err) {
tl.setResult(tl.TaskResult.Failed, `${err}`);
} finally {
if (tl.exist(cliPath) && loggedIn) {
// logout
let logoutRunner = tl.tool(cliPath);
logoutRunner.arg(['logout', '--quiet']);
await logoutRunner.exec();
}
}
}
run();
